Remarks on the sermon, adapted to the state of the times, preached by the Rev. John Stephens, in the Methodist Chapel Oldham Street, Manchester

Archive Print part: YAS 1060

Details

Type of record: Book

Title: Remarks on the sermon, adapted to the state of the times, preached by the Rev. John Stephens, in the Methodist Chapel Oldham Street, Manchester

Level: Piece

Classmark: YAS 1060

Creator(s): Scholefield, James (1789-1853)

Additional creator(s): Barnes, Ralph (1781-1869) (Printer)

Related people: Stephens, John, 1772-1841; Barnes, Ralph

Publisher: Printed for, and sold by the author

Publication city: Manchester

Date(s): 1819

Language: English

Size and medium: 24 p

Description

"R. Barnes, printer, Manchester" - colophon.

Additional description

Bound with 13 other publications in volume with spine title: 'Tracts'. Volume contents: 1. The political "A, Apple-pie", or, The "Extraordinary red book". 1820. -- 2. The total eclipse. [1820] -- 3. The Queen's matrimonial ladder. 1820. -- 4. The political house that Jack built. 1820. -- 5. The Man in the moon &c. &c. &c. 1820. -- 6. "Non mi ricordo!" 1820. -- 7. The political showman -- at home! 1821. -- 8. The coronation dirge. [1820?] -- 9. The lament of the Emerald Isle. 1818. -- 10. The Queen's case stated. 1820. -- 11. Royalty fog-bound. 1815. -- 12. Proceedings in the House of Commons [etc.] [1818] -- 13. Remarks on the sermon [etc.] 1819. -- 14. Huddersfield Festival, 1821. [1821] With a list of contents in manuscript on flyleaf. Item no.13: with manuscript annotations on title page
